The position is primarily responsible for customer and staff management, whilst ensuring all services provided to our clients are delivered in direct alignment to contractual and legal requirements.
In this fast-paced and exciting role, you will use your contract management, analytical and interpersonal skills to deliver security services to new and existing clients. As the Business Manager, you will be promote and maintain strong business relationships, monitor and measure contractual performance and lead security teams across a portfolio of clients.
Additional duties include, but are not limited to:
- Develop and maintain business goals, plans, and strategies through analysing data, reporting, and identifying individual client needs.
- Identify and converting revenue growth opportunities with new and existing clients.
- Read, write, and interpret a range of documents, including quotations, proposals, contracts, agreements, and tenders.
- Read and interpret policies and procedures, code of conduct, industrial relations laws and Awards.
- Lead, coach and develop large teams across multiple sites.
Skills & Experience
- Prior industry experience
- Extensive experience managing large numbers of people
- Business development experience
- Previous experience dealing with Industrial Relations and Industry Awards / Agreements
- Proven experience dealing with client contracts and or tender submissions
Qualifications
- Current Security licence or ability to obtain
- Current drivers licence
- Relevant Tertiary qualifications are advantageous but not essential
